Role Description

Reactive synthesis for specifications over bounded integer domains, such as fixed-width bitvectors, is typically handled by discretization via “bit-blasting”: each bit of the bounded integer is encoded as an independent Boolean signal, and the resulting specification is solved with plain LTL synthesis tools. While bit-blasting is simple and reuses existing solvers, it destroys the arithmetic structure of the domain, and the state space explored during synthesis grows exponentially with the bitwidth, making synthesis impractical for all but the smallest domains. LTL Modulo Theories (LTL^T) generalizes reactive synthesis to reason about theory atoms directly rather than plain Booleans, and has been shown to scale to infinite domains, such as integers and reals, using SMT-based reasoning. Bounded domains, such as bitvectors, pose a different challenge: because the domain is finite and equipped with a specific modular and bit-level structure, decision procedures specialized for bounded integer arithmetic may enable synthesis algorithms that avoid the cost of bit-blasting while remaining decidable and efficient. In this internship we will explore reactive synthesis modulo bounded integer theories, such as bitvectors, using theory reasoning over the bounded domain directly rather than blasting it into individual bits, aiming for synthesis algorithms whose cost scales much more gently with the bitwidth. We will then investigate which other “simple theories” admit decidable and practically efficient synthesis procedures, with the goal of building a family of fast, specialized synthesis tools for these theories.
